Kode Mata Kuliah | IF2050 / 3 SKS |
---|
Penyelenggara | 135 - Informatics/Computer Science / STEI |
---|
Kategori | Lecture |
---|
| Bahasa Indonesia | English |
---|
Nama Mata Kuliah | Dasar Rekayasa Perangkat Lunak | Foundations of Software Engineering |
---|
Bahan Kajian |
| - SE-SEF-2. Software Construction
- SE-SEF-7. Construction tools
- SE-MAA-1. Modeling foundations
- SE-REQ-1. Requirements fundamentals
- SE-REQ-2. Eliciting requirements
- SE-REQ-3. Requirements specification and documentation
- SE-REQ-4. Requirements validation
- SE-DES-1. Design concepts
- SE-DES-2. Design strategies
- SE-DES-3. Architectural design
- SE-DES-5. Detailed design
- SE-VAV-1. V&V terminology and foundations
- SE-VAV-3. Testing
- SE-PRO-1. Process concepts
- SE-PRO-6. Type of Process – Waterfall, Iterative, Scrum, Agile
- CS-SP-3. Professional Ethics
|
---|
Capaian Pembelajaran Mata Kuliah (CPMK) | - CPMK1. Menjelaskan prinsip dasar dan komponen fundametal rekayasa perangkat lunak
- CPMK2. Membuat analisis dan rancangan perangkat lunak dengan menggunakan sejumlah teknik dan alat bantu
- CPMK3. Membangun perangkat lunak sesuai dengan hasil rancangan
- CPMK4. Melakukan pengujian perangkat lunak secara
|
|
---|
Metode Pembelajaran | Kuliah, Presentasi, Diskusi, Project-based study, Case study, Problem-based Learning, Studi literatur, Kerja kelompok, Project-based Learning (PBL), Tutorial | |
---|
Modalitas Pembelajaran | Daring/Luring
Sinkron/Asinkron
Mandiri/Kelompok | |
---|
Jenis Nilai | ABCDE |
---|
Metode Penilaian | UTS, UAS, Kuis, Tugas | |
---|
Catatan Tambahan | | |
---|